    Truly I don't follow officials much. What's the thoughts on Capers and Zarba?
    Capers and Zarba worked Game 6 of the SA/DAL series (along with Jason Phillips)

    Capers is pretty solid, but I think he tends sometimes to get caught up in the emotion of a home crowd.

    Zarba's assignment here is really curious to me. I didn't think he was likely to have made the Finals crew, but this assignment suggests that he might have. Tonight will be only his 4th conference finals game, which can be worrisome. While I think Zarba is a better official now than he was a few years ago, I think he's still prone to guessing on close plays. Zarba and Pop have some history; I know that Zarba ran Pop in a home game against Dallas a few seasons ago and I think there are few officials who even have a shot to call games at this level that are more frustrating to Pop than Zarba (though Ed Malloy would certainly appear to be another).
